Effect of Membrane Lipid Peroxidation on Liver Mitochondrial Functions


Abstract
The effect of the membrane lipid peroxidation levels on rat liver mitochondrial functions was investigated by in vitro test.
In in vitro test, the exposure time of liver homogenates to oxygen tensions was 0, 3, 6, 9, 12 hours and the lipid peroxidation levels were evaluated by the measurements fluorescent intensity and malondialdehyde(MDA). The fluorescent intensity of homogenates and mitochondrial suspension were elevated, and the concentration of MDA was not affected as time progressed. Therefore, fluorescent intensity for lipid peroxidation values were used to analize the correlation between lipid peroxidation levels and mitochondrial functions.
When the exposure time to oxygen was gradually increased in mitochondrial suspensions, fluorescent intensity was elevated, total mitochondrial activity and ATPase activity were decreased. The correlation between fluorescent intensity and total mitochondrial activity or ATPase activity were analyzed and the inverse correlation was -0.92, -0.64, respectively.
